The Push Notifications & Devices page allows you to enable browser-based push notifications in Chrome, test that they’re working correctly, manage connected devices, and view a history of important system notifications like incomming customer communications and medication orders.


📌 What are Push Notifications?

Push notifications are real-time alerts that appear on your desktop (even if Scrypt HQ isn’t open) to keep you informed about key activity, like:

  • 📩 A new communication message from a patient (SMS, App, or Email)

  • 🛒 A new customer order has been placed.

  • ✅ System notfications that indicate oustanding actions required.

These notifications help you stay on top of customer needs without actively checking Scrypt HQ.


🛠️ Setting Up Push Notifications (Chrome Only)

⚠️ Push Notifications are currently supported only in Google Chrome Browsers.

  • Open the Settings Page
    Navigate to Settings > Push Notifications in Scrypt HQ.

  • Step 1 - Enable Brwoser Notification permissions
    Click the Test Browser Notification Ability. You’ll be prompted by Chrome to allow notifications.

    • Click "Allow" when prompted.

    • If you don’t see a prompt, follow the instructions below the button to enable notification permissions for your browser.

    • You have completed this step when you see that Browser Permission Status is set to Enabled.

  • Step 2 - Add your browser (device) to allow Scrypt to send Push Notification
    Use the + Add device button to ensure you have added this computers browser (aka device) everything is set up correctly. You can also use the 'Test/Test all devices' button to push a test notificaiton to your current/all connected devices.


💻 Managing Connected Devices

Each browser or device where you enable notifications will appear in your Connected Devices list. You can:

  • ✅ See which devices are currently active

  • ❌ Revoke access to old or unused devices

This ensures you only get alerts on devices you still use.


🧾 Viewing Past Notifications

You can view a log of received notifications under the Notification History section:

  • When notification was sent

  • Which Device ID it was sent to

  • The type of trigger that prompted the notifcation, e.g SMS, Order Received, Order Updated etc.

  • Message content

  • Platform: Scrypt HQ (Web), or Scrypt Mobile (Mobile)

This is helpful if you accidentally dismissed a notification or want to review recent activity.

  • Using a different browser?
    Currently, only Chrome is supported. Support for other browsers is coming soon.

  • Multiple browser profiles?
    Push notifications are user-specific. Each different browser profile member must enable them from their own browser.


💡 Best Practices

  • We recommend enabling notifications on one primary workstation per user to avoid duplicate alerts.

  • Clear out old devices regularly to keep your alerts streamlined.
